こんばんは、NORIです。
先日始めたWEB系の復習・勉強の為の作業ですが、
昨今はAzureで公開した段階で勝手に常時SSL(httpsでの接続)化されるようです。
証明書発行して~の下りが非常に厄介そうだったのでどうしたものかと。
http→httpsの強制リダイレクトは..まぁいいでしょう。
あとは適当にSEO対策乗せてみて、何かしら認証をと。
ん? 認証画面必要?
将来的には特定の画面のみ認証かけたいので、使うとしたら「ASP.NET Identity」
業務で用いた経験のあるダイジェスト認証については、備忘録として以下に残します。
手順: テスト環境でのみ認証をかける
htaccessかどうか NO → .netでは以下が有名。
1. NugetPackageで「HttpAuthModule」をインストールする。
2. Web.configが書き換わるので、それをバックアップに残してWeb.configを元通りにする
3. Testビルドを作成し、先のバックアップの通りになるようにWeb.Test.configを編集する